Joseph F. Mchale

June 15, 1942 — July 31, 2021

Joseph F. McHale, “Buddy”, 79, passed away peacefully at the home of his daughter, Jeanie in Arlington Vermont on Saturday July 31, 2021 after a 3 ½ year battle with cancer. Buddy was born in Brooklyn, NY on June 12, 1942. He was the son of Thomas McHale (“Pop pop”) and Loretta (Kearney) McHale (deceased), brother of Tom in North Carolina and Jack (deceased). He lived the first half of his life in New York and the second half in South Florida. With his health declining he relocated to his daughter’s home in Vermont where he raved about the home cooked meals and happy hours. Bud was a successful securities trader, trading till his last days. He was also a passionate and skilled golfer, which brought him to some of the most beautiful places in the world, including his home courses. He was a very social person who enjoyed a proper cocktail (to the top!), and a great meal with great company, especially that of Penny and his amazing friends, who he cherished. Predeceased by his wife Patricia (O’Connor) McHale, Buddy leaves his son Joseph F. McHale Jr. and his wife Lauren of Washington D.C., daughters Jeanie McHale and her husband John Spencer of Arlington, VT, Patricia McHale of New York, NY, Elizabeth Kuenzel and her husband Mark, Springfield, MA and Eileen McHale of Yonkers, NY, five grandchildren (Trey, Connor, Ryan, Andrew, Lily) and one great grandchild (Vida). At Buddy’s request there will be no formal services, but his family encourages you to raise a glass (or several) to a life well lived. If you would like to make a memorial gift in his memory please donate to OIF.org, the Osteogenesis Imperfecta Foundation (brittle bones disease).
